class BuildCacheManager {
constructor(outDir, executableFile, arch) {
this.executableFile = executableFile;
this.cacheInfo = null;
this.newDigest = null;
this.cacheDir = path.join(outDir, ".cache", _builderUtil().Arch[arch]);
this.cacheFile = path.join(this.cacheDir, "app.exe");
this.cacheInfoFile = path.join(this.cacheDir, "info.json");
}
async copyIfValid(digest) {
this.newDigest = digest;
this.cacheInfo = await (0, _promise().orNullIfFileNotExist)((0, _fsExtra().readJson)(this.cacheInfoFile));
const oldDigest = this.cacheInfo == null ? null : this.cacheInfo.executableDigest;
if (oldDigest !== digest) {
_builderUtil().log.debug({
oldDigest,
newDigest: digest
}, "no valid cached executable found");
return false;
}
_builderUtil().log.debug({
cacheFile: this.cacheFile,
file: this.executableFile
}, `copying cached executable`);
try {
await (0, _fs().copyFile)(this.cacheFile, this.executableFile, false);
return true;
} catch (e) {
if (e.code === "ENOENT" || e.code === "ENOTDIR") {
_builderUtil().log.debug({
error: e.code
}, "copy cached executable failed");
} else {
_builderUtil().log.warn({
error: e.stack || e
}, `cannot copy cached executable`);
}
}
return false;
}
async save() {
if (this.newDigest == null) {
throw new Error("call copyIfValid before");
}
if (this.cacheInfo == null) {
this.cacheInfo = {
executableDigest: this.newDigest
};
} else {
this.cacheInfo.executableDigest = this.newDigest;
}
try {
await (0, _fsExtra().ensureDir)(this.cacheDir);
await Promise.all([(0, _fsExtra().writeJson)(this.cacheInfoFile, this.cacheInfo), (0, _fs().copyFile)(this.executableFile, this.cacheFile, false)]);
} catch (e) {
_builderUtil().log.warn({
error: e.stack || e
}, `cannot save build cache`);
}
}
}
exports.BuildCacheManager = BuildCacheManager;
BuildCacheManager.VERSION = "0";
async function digest(hash, files) {
// do not use pipe - better do bulk file read (https://github.com/yarnpkg/yarn/commit/7a63e0d23c46a4564bc06645caf8a59690f04d01)
for (const content of await _bluebirdLst().default.map(files, it => (0, _fsExtra().readFile)(it))) {
hash.update(content);
}
hash.update(BuildCacheManager.VERSION);
return hash.digest("base64");
}
